Property Details for 15 Damon St, Singleton

15 Damon St, Singleton is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1981. The property has a land size of 870m2 and floor size of 140m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in March 2015.

About Singleton 6175

The size of Singleton is approximately 3.8 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 24.8% of total area. The population of Singleton in 2016 was 3752 people. By 2021 the population was 4021 showing a population growth of 7.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Singleton is 10-19 years. Households in Singleton are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Singleton work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 79.90% of the homes in Singleton were owner-occupied compared with 77.40% in 2016.

Singleton has 1,930 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Singleton have seen a 128.55%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 123.97%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Singleton is $922,146 while the median value for Units is $521,989.
  • Houses have a median rent of $650.
